SUMMARY

The successful candidate for this position will be responsible for providing civil engineering support for a wide variety of land development projects including residential, commercial, institutional, industrial, resort, recreation, infrastructure, and attraction.

A TYPICAL DAY MIGHT INCLUDE

Our exciting and entrepreneurial culture will require you to think creatively, solve problems and meet the needs of our clients daily. A typical day might include the following:

  • Preparing and overseeing civil engineering design for site geometry, grading, drainage, roadway, water distribution, wastewater collection/transmission, parks and other civil improvements.
  • Preparing and overseeing development of design drawings, technical specifications, reports, cost estimates and other project deliverables.
  • Analyzing technical information, performing engineering calculations, and advancing design concepts into effective and financially feasible engineering designs.
  • Authoring technical reports such as due diligence reports, feasibility reports, design reports, and technical memoranda.
  • Providing technical support throughout all project stages from request for proposal through final design and construction.
  • Serving as Engineer of Record for various projects and/or project tasks.
  • Preparing and participating in client meetings and presentations.
  • Providing leadership and guidance for engineering interns and technicians.
